Commonly Seen Sewer Line Issues

Broken: cracked, offset or collapsed pipe: Pipes have been damaged due to moving soil, frozen ground, settling, and so on.
Blockage: Grease accumulation or a foreign things is restricting or prohibiting correct flow and/or cleaning of the line.
Corrosion: The pipe has actually deteriorated and/or broken, triggering collapses in the line and restricting circulation.
Bellied pipe: An area of the pipeline has actually sunk due to ground or soil conditions, developing a valley that collects paper and waste.
Leaking joints: The seals in between pipes have broken, allowing water to leave into the area surrounding the pipeline.
Root in drain line: Tree or shrub roots have actually gotten into the drain line and/or have actually harmed the line, preventing typical cleansing.
Off-grade pipe: Existing pipes are constructed of subpar material that might have weakened or corroded.

Traditional Sewage Line Repair Method

Sewer line repair is typically performed utilizing the "open cut" or "trench" approach to gain access to the area surrounding the damaged part of the pipeline. A backhoe might be used to open and fill up the workspace.

Pipe Bursting

We make little gain access to holes where the damaged pipe starts and ends. Using your damaged sewage system line as a guide, our hydraulic machine pulls full-sized replacement pipeline through the old course and breaks up the harmed pipeline at the very same time. The brand-new pipeline is highly resistant to leaks and root invasion, with a long life expectancy.

Pipe Relining Process


Relining is the procedure of fixing damaged drain pipes by creating a "pipeline within a pipeline" to restore function and flow. Epoxy relining products mold to the inside of the existing pipe to produce a smooth brand-new inner wall, much like the lining discovered in food cans.

Sometimes, pipeline relining can be carried out through a building's clean-out access and often requires little digging. Pipeline relining may be used to fix root-damaged pipes; seal fractures and holes; and fill in missing out on pipe and seal joint connections underground, in roof drain pipelines, in storm lines and under concrete. The relined pipe is smooth and long lasting, and all materials utilized in the relining process are non-hazardous.
